Dickens of a Christmas recreates the time of Charles Dickens using historic downtown Franklin’s charming architecture as the backdrop. A variety of musicians, dancers and Dickens characters will fill the streets. Expect to see and interact with the nefarious Fagin from Oliver Twist; Jacob Marley, Ebenezer Scrooge, Tiny Tim and the rest of the Cratchit family from A Christmas Carol; and of course, a Victorian Father and Mother Christmas with treats for children. The festival is produced by the Heritage Foundation of Williamson County and the Downtown Franklin Association!

St. Peter’s Episcopal Church presents a service of Lessons and Carols on Sunday, December 15, at 3:00pm in the St. Peter’s sanctuary located at 311 West 7th Street in downtown Columbia, next door to the Polk Home.

This traditional Anglican service originated in the Church of England in the late 1800s and was later formalized as a Christmas service. After the devastation of World War I it has been broadcast by the BBC around the world ever since. The service includes scripture readings from the Old and New Testaments that tell the story of the birth of Jesus. The remainder of the service includes audience Christmas carols and choir anthems performed by the St. Peter’s Choir.

This event is free and open to the public with no tickets required. A livestream will be available on Facebook at and the St. Peter’s website.

The Building Block School for the Arts is thrilled to present A Maury Christmas Carol, a fresh adaptation of Charles Dickens’ beloved holiday classic. Set against the backdrop of downtown Columbia in 1937, this reimagined story unfolds during the hardships of the Great Depression. Familiar characters come to life as Tennesseans of all walks of life, each navigating their own challenges during a time of adversity.

Adding a rich layer of authenticity, the gifted Murphey Ridge Band will perform live, filling the play with timeless 1930s Christmas tunes that will transport audiences to a bygone era.

This heartwarming production is directed by Sherry Johnson, founder of the Building Block School for the Arts, and features an original script adaptation by Carter Crocker, an Emmy-winning writer celebrated for his work in children’s animation.

Multi-platinum-selling artists Amy Grant and Vince Gill have announced their return to Nashville’s historic Ryman Auditorium in 2024 for their 14th annual “Christmas at the Ryman” residency. The 12-concert run at the Ryman is scheduled for Nov. 29-30, Dec. 1, 15, 17-18 and 20-21 and will once again feature matinee performances.

For many years, the “Christmas at the Ryman” shows have been the ultimate holiday tradition, with music fans from across the country and around the world flocking to the historic venue to hear two of Nashville’s most cherished performers. Last year, Grant and Gill celebrated their 100th “Christmas at the Ryman” show during their sold-out residency, making them the first artists to headline 100 shows at the Ryman. In years past, the duo has filled the show with Christmas favorites such as “It’s The Most Wonderful Time of the Year,” “O Holy Night,” “Tennessee Christmas,” and “Winter Wonderland.”
